Hola,
Me gustaría saber cómo puedo hacer un ránking con PHP, para que los usuarios puedan puntuar cada cosa, y poner comentarios, también me gustaría que un usuario registrado sólo pueda votar una vez.
Muchas gracias por adelantado!!!
| |||
![]() Hola, Me gustaría saber cómo puedo hacer un ránking con PHP, para que los usuarios puedan puntuar cada cosa, y poner comentarios, también me gustaría que un usuario registrado sólo pueda votar una vez. Muchas gracias por adelantado!!! |
| |||
Re: Ranking en PHP Hola! puedes concretar mas la duda q tienes? lo q quieres hacer o buscas alguna cosa pre-fabricada? saludos ![]()
__________________ "Cada hombre es el hijo de su propio trabajo" Miguel de Cervantes Saavedra "La experiencia es algo que no consigues hasta justo depués de necesitarla" Laurence Olivier |
| ||||
Re: Ranking en PHP Cita: "para que los usuarios puedan puntuar cada cosa" debes tener registrado que es esa "cosa", si esos datos están en base de datos vas por el lado correcto."poner comentarios", aquí tienes que ver como lo vas a implementar, si cada "cosa" solamente va a tener vinculado los comentarios, tienes que hacer una tabla "comentarios" con los campos (cosa_id | comentario) y si tambien quieres saber que usuario hizo el comentario solo le debes agregar un campo usuario_id. "me gustaría que un usuario registrado sólo pueda votar una vez", te sugiero que hagas una tabla "ranking" con los campos (usuario_id | cosa_id | puntuacion) con esto tienes solucionado que usuario puntuó cada cosa, y para que no vote dos veces la misma "cosa", antes de insertar cada registro en la tabla "ranking" buscas el usuario y la "cosa" que se está votando y si no concuerdan los registros se inserta en la base de datos, sino, muestras un mensaje, lo envías a otra página u otra cosa. este es solamente mi sugerencia, espero que te sea de utilidad. |